On 11/24/2022 at 9:12 PM, dibarlaw said:

The aluminum one is a 1926 or 1927. The I.D. size will tell if it is for a Master or Standard. The block Letter example is 1923 and a few years earlier. Size will indicate 4 or 6 cylinder application.

Thanks. Can anyone expand on the size differences? The aluminum cap is 3 1/4" outside diameter, the brass one is 3 1/2".

The 3-1/2" OD cap fits Master.  My Master alum cap measured around 3.55" and brass cap measured 3.51".

Standard cap for years 1926-28 is approx 3-3/8" OD and made from alum.  Mine has script lettering. 

Another cap in my collection is approx 3.3" OD, alum with block lettering  and does not fit a Standard hub.
